ronaly agdeppa wrote:
>> ronaly wrote:
>>> DDK handles the creation of custompagesize by just adding like this example code:
>>>    VariablePaperSize Yes
>>>    MinSize 216 216
>>>    MaxSize 612 1020
>>>
>>> However, in a CustomPageSize query I need to add some code to make my printer works for a customized paper size.
>>>
>>> Is there a way I can append additional code in the CustomPageSize query?
>>> *CustomPageSize True: "pop pop pop <</PageSize[5 -2 roll]/ImagingBBox null>>setpagedevice"
>> Instead of using the convenience directives, specify the values as
>> attributes, e.g.:
>>
>>      Attribute CustomPageSize True "your code"
>>      Attribute ParamCustomPageSize Width "1 points min max"
>>      Attribute ParamCustomPageSize Height "2 points min max"
>>      Attribute ParamCustomPageSize WidthOffset "3 points 0 0"
>>      Attribute ParamCustomPageSize HeightOffset "4 points 0 0"
>>      Attribute ParamCustomPageSize Orientation "5 integer 3 3"
>>      Attribute HWMargins "" "left bottom right top"

> Hi Michael,
> 
> Thank you for always responding.
> 
> I tried that already but in the generated ppd,
> ParamCustomPageSize were not included.
> 
> DDK cannot generate ParamCustomPageSize when manually added as attributes.
> 
> I'm using cupsddk 1.2.3

Strange, because the DDK doesn't filter attributes.

Can you post a link to your .drv file?
